Course Details


• Disability and Inclusion in Humanitarian Contexts
• Understanding Disability and its Intersection with Humanitarian Crises
• Disability-Inclusive Disaster Risk Reduction and Emergency Preparedness
• Protection of Persons with Disabilities in Humanitarian Crises
• Accessibility and Assistive Technology in Humanitarian Settings
• Disability-Inclusive Humanitarian Program Cycle: Assessment, Design, Implementation, and Monitoring & Evaluation
• Legal Frameworks for the Protection of Persons with Disabilities in Humanitarian Contexts
• Engaging and Empowering Persons with Disabilities in Humanitarian Action
• Case Management and Support for Persons with Disabilities in Humanitarian Crises
• Mainstreaming Disability in Humanitarian Capacity Building and Training Programs
